Reorganise USB stack defines. Now config.h decides which class drivers get enabled...
commitf146de6c16013206bdda8ef04b4321711312d699
authorgevaerts <gevaerts@a1c6a512-1295-4272-9138-f99709370657>
Sat, 23 May 2009 14:30:20 +0000 (23 14:30 +0000)
committergevaerts <gevaerts@a1c6a512-1295-4272-9138-f99709370657>
Sat, 23 May 2009 14:30:20 +0000 (23 14:30 +0000)
treef9056ad1a886d1741b009a6d026b689e18040a17
parentfdf762121475f0d3f0cb08652274b7cf00a16944
Reorganise USB stack defines. Now config.h decides which class drivers get enabled instead of usb_core.h
Also enable HID, and use that as the dummy class instead of charging-only for controllers that have working interrupt transfers.

git-svn-id: svn://svn.rockbox.org/rockbox/trunk@21053 a1c6a512-1295-4272-9138-f99709370657
13 files changed:
apps/debug_menu.c
firmware/SOURCES
firmware/export/config-gigabeat-s.h
firmware/export/config-iaudio7.h
firmware/export/config.h
firmware/export/usb_core.h
firmware/logf.c
firmware/usb.c
firmware/usbstack/usb_charging_only.c
firmware/usbstack/usb_core.c
firmware/usbstack/usb_hid.c
firmware/usbstack/usb_serial.c
firmware/usbstack/usb_storage.c